About this role.
This is a full-time US-remote Customer Marketing Manager role focused on North American K-12 customers. The manager will develop scalable lifecycle, digital, field, webinar, and event programs that increase product adoption, engagement, retention, and cross-sell readiness. The position partners closely with Customer Success, Sales, Renewals, Community, ABM, and Marketing teams and measures outcomes using customer, product-usage, and campaign data. Candidates need 7+ years of B2B SaaS customer, lifecycle, or post-sale marketing experience, along with marketing automation and customer-data platform expertise.

Sample interview questions
I would begin by defining the target customer segments, desired behavior change, baseline adoption metrics, and the leading indicators most connected to retention. I would then build a triggered, multi-channel journey using product-usage signals, educational content, customer communications, and success-team outreach, testing messages and channels before scaling what improves engagement and health scores.
I would create a shared operating model with Customer Success, Renewals, Sales, and Marketing that defines segments, ownership, campaign handoffs, and success metrics. Regular performance reviews would connect marketing engagement and product-usage data to renewal risk, expansion readiness, and field feedback so teams can act on the same customer signals.
I would use a combination of product-usage indicators, campaign engagement, customer health, retention rates, renewal outcomes, and expansion pipeline influence. I would report results by segment and cohort, compare performance against baselines, and distinguish leading engagement indicators from lagging commercial outcomes.
I would segment accounts using factors such as product adoption, customer maturity, renewal timing, persona, purchased products, engagement history, and expansion potential. The resulting tiers would receive different journeys, with high-risk accounts receiving value-realization support and high-potential accounts receiving relevant cross-sell education and coordinated account-based outreach.
I would prioritize the work by expected customer and business impact, urgency, effort, and confidence in the underlying data. I would launch a small number of high-impact, measurable programs first, establish reusable campaign templates and dashboards, and maintain a transparent roadmap so stakeholders understand tradeoffs and sequencing.

At Instructure, we’re looking for a Manager of Customer Marketing to drive adoption, retention, and expansion across our K-12 customers in North America.
This role focuses on helping customers realize value, ensuring they’re engaged, successful, and getting the most out of our products. You’ll build and scale programs that deepen product usage, strengthen relationships, and ultimately support long-term retention and expansion.
You’ll play a key role in shaping and supporting cross-sell, partnering closely with our ABM Manager and Marketing Managers to align on strategy and execution.
What you will do:
Drive adoption and customer value
Design and execute programs that increase product usage, engagement, and customer health across our K-12 customer base.
Strengthen retention
Build lifecycle and engagement strategies that reduce churn risk and support renewal, working closely with Customer Success and Renewals teams.
Develop scalable customer programs
Create repeatable, data-driven programs using digital campaigns, customer communications, and targeted initiatives that reach customers at the right time with the right message.
Partner on expansion strategy
Collaborate with ABM and Marketing Managers to support cross-sell efforts, contributing insights, segmentation, and program support to drive expansion opportunities.
Run integrated campaigns (digital + field + events)
Execute campaigns that combine digital marketing with customer events, webinars, and field programs to increase engagement and product adoption.
Turn insights into action
Use customer data, product usage signals, and campaign performance to continuously refine programs and improve outcomes.
Align cross-functional teams
Work closely with Customer Success, Sales, Renewals, Community, and Marketing to ensure a consistent and effective customer experience.
Measure impact
Track and report on key metrics like product adoption, engagement, retention, and campaign performance.
What you need to know/have:
7+ years in customer marketing, lifecycle marketing, or post-sale marketing in B2B SaaS
Strong track record driving adoption, engagement, and retention
Experience building and scaling customer lifecycle programs
Ability to partner cross-functionally with Customer Success, Sales, and Marketing
Experience supporting (not necessarily owning) expansion or cross-sell motions
Hands-on experience with marketing automation and customer data tools (Marketo, Salesforce, Gainsight, etc.)
Analytical mindset—you use data to guide decisions and improve performance
Strong communication skills and ability to influence without direct ownership
Bonus Points if you also have:
Experience in EdTech or K-12
Familiarity with account-based or customer segmentation strategies
Experience working with product usage data to drive marketing programs
